Understanding Monroeville Public Records

Monroeville Public Records are documents and information that are created, received, or maintained by the local government of Monroeville. These records include a wide range of information, from property records and court documents to marriage licenses and birth certificates. The public records in Monroeville are managed by various departments within the local government, each responsible for a specific type of record.

Accessing Monroeville Public Records

Access to Monroeville Public Records is governed by the New Jersey Open Public Records Act (OPRA). This law ensures that the public has the right to access government records, with certain exceptions for privacy and security reasons. To request public records in Monroeville, individuals can submit a request to the appropriate department, either in person, by mail, or online.
